Good infrastructure and campus life, but faculty and placements need improvement.
Placements: Around 75-85% of eligible students get placed each year through campus recruitment. The highest package offered is 12 LPA, while the lowest package is around 3-4 LPA, with the average package ranging between 4.5-6 LPA. Top recruiting company is cognizant.
Infrastructure: The department is equipped with modern labs such as the VLSI lab, DSP lab, and embedded systems lab, along with high-speed Wi-Fi, smart classrooms, and access to a well-stocked library with digital resources. The hostel provides facilities like clean rooms, regular housekeeping, 24/7 water, and electricity supply. The mess provides hygienic food.
Faculty: The teachers at the college are helpful, well-qualified, and possess good subject knowledge. They are ready to clear doubts both during and after class hours. Semester exams are moderately difficult and require consistent preparation. The questions are usually based on the syllabus, with a mix of theory and problem-solving.
Other: I was interested in this branch. We can go for core companies as well, and we can go for IT jobs. In college, there are college fests, a hostel fest, and a branch fest as well. All the events are conducted in a very disciplined manner.

A good university for those who want a decent overall experience.
Placements: Placements in our college are quite average. The highest salary package offered in my course is 47 LPA by Adobe. Around 70% of students are placed, with the average salary package ranging from 5-7 LPA. There's little to no information on the lowest salary package, but I'd wager it is about 3 LPA. College does not provide internships, but being located in Bangalore should help quite a bit in terms of internship availability.
Infrastructure: College is very beautiful in terms of landscaping and also contains an artificial lake within the campus. Architecture is outdated. Classrooms, labs, and other facilities are just average. Library is good, spacious with a vast collection of books. An infirmary is available on campus to deal with any physical injuries.
Faculty: Teachers here are good and experienced. Unlike other universities nearby, there are no such crazy rules and regulations but there are reasonable rules. Curriculum followed by JSS is set by VTU, so it is quite rigorous but not very updated/relevant. Semester exams are moderately difficult and are set by VTU. Internals are pretty easy.
Other: I chose ECE because of my passion for the field. It offers a wide variety of job opportunities after graduation. Fests and sports events are organized regularly by the college.

Q:   Is it easy to get admission in JSS Academy of Technical Education?
A: 

Yes, you can easily get admission to the JSS Academy of Technical Education if you fulfill the eligibility criteria.

Eighty-five percent of the total intake in the B.Tech. first year is filled through Dr. APJ Abdul Kalam Technical University Lucknow Counseling, based on the rank in the JEE Main entrance exam, as per the Uttar Pradesh Government's order. 

To be eligible for the B.Tech program, candidates must have passed the 10+2 examination with Physics and Mathematics as compulsory subjects and Chemistry as an optional subject, securing 45% marks in these subjects combined (40% for candidates belonging to reserved categories).

Q:   What entrance exams are accepted by JSS Academy of Technical Education for admission to B.Tech.?
A: 

JSS Academy of Technical Education (JSSATE) accepts the following entrance exams for admission to B.Tech programs:

JEE Main: JSSATE accepts JEE Main scores for admission to B.Tech and Integrated B.Tech courses. 

UPTAC: JSSATE accepts UPTAC scores for admission to B.Tech programs. 

KCET: JSSATE accepts KCET scores for admission to B.Tech programs. 

COMEDK UGET: JSSATE accepts COMEDK UGET scores for admission to B.Tech programs. 

JSSATE also offers direct admission to 15% of B.Tech seats through the Management Quota. To be eligible for direct admission, candidates must have passed 10+2 with Physics and Mathematics as compulsory subjects, and Chemistry as an optional subject, with a minimum of 60% marks in all subjects.
